What is Huntington Ingalls Industries's operating lease liabilities?
Huntington Ingalls Industries (HII) reported operating lease liabilities of $230M in Q1 2026.
How has Huntington Ingalls Industries's operating lease liabilities changed year-over-year?
Huntington Ingalls Industries's operating lease liabilities increased by 12.7% year-over-year, from $204M to $230M.
What is the long-term trend for Huntington Ingalls Industries's operating lease liabilities?
Over 5 years (2020 to 2025), Huntington Ingalls Industries's operating lease liabilities has grown at a 7.3%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$157M to $223M.
What does operating lease liabilities mean?
The long-term portion of payments due for leased assets.
How do you interpret operating lease liabilities?
An increase indicates higher long-term lease commitments, which effectively function as a form of debt.
